What Role Does Oxidation Participate in while in the Efficacy Of Iron Filtration techniques?

Filtration procedures are vital in ensuring you have use of clear and Secure drinking drinking water. For anyone who is dealing with significant amounts of iron inside your h2o, being familiar with the position of oxidation in iron filtration programs is vital for maximizing their effectiveness.

Iron arrives mainly in two sorts: ferrous (dissolved) and ferric (particulate). The oxidation process converts ferrous iron into ferric iron, which drastically impacts your filtration program's ability to remove iron from h2o.

When you've got ferrous iron in your drinking water, it's soluble and invisible until it oxidizes to sort ferric iron. the moment ferric iron is formed, it precipitates out in the drinking water, which lets your filtration method to trap these larger sized particles.

primarily, oxidation makes it probable to your filtration unit to capture iron that could if not continue to be dissolved instead of be taken out. In the event your method is created to deal with iron, the oxidation method happens utilizing various approaches, such as aeration, chemical oxidation, or catalytic oxidation.

Aeration is probably the easiest and mostly applied solutions for iron oxidation. In this process, air is introduced in to the h2o, allowing for ferrous ions to respond with oxygen. This response converts ferrous iron to ferric iron efficiently.

If you decide for an aeration method in your home, you can expect to detect that it don't just will help with iron elimination but may also enrich the general aesthetic top quality on the drinking water. on the other hand, ensure that proper routine maintenance is applied to maintain the aeration process functioning optimally.

Chemical oxidation may additionally be an option for you. Chemicals like chlorine or potassium permanganate can explicitly concentrate on dissolved iron and transform it to your sound sort that could be filtered out. This method might be especially efficient in additional critical water situations the place significant quantities of iron are present.

When employing this technique, it really is very important to regulate the dosing accurately to avoid more than-oxidation, which often can introduce other undesirable byproducts into your h2o.

Other than aeration and chemical treatment, catalytic oxidation methods are getting to be increasingly well-known. They use special media that facilitate the oxidation of iron with no have to have For added chemicals or aeration gear.

These units may be very efficient and could require much less servicing than regular types, making them a protracted-expression expense for you personally.
